The German word Thermostat refers to a technical device designed to monitor and regulate temperature automatically. In a German-speaking context, you will encounter this word most frequently when discussing home heating systems (Heizung), automotive cooling, or industrial processes. Unlike English, where the word is identical in spelling, the German pronunciation emphasizes the final syllable and treats the initial 'Th' as a simple 'T' sound. Understanding how to use this word is essential for navigating daily life in Germany, especially during the winter months when managing the Nebenkosten (utility costs) is a national pastime.

Technical Function
In engineering, a Thermostat is a component which senses the temperature of a physical system and performs actions so that the system's temperature is maintained near a desired setpoint. In German homes, this is usually the twist-knob on a radiator.
Domestic Context
When a German says, 'Dreh das Thermostat bitte runter,' they are usually referring to the radiator valve. Modern German flats often feature 'smarte Thermostate' that can be controlled via smartphone to save energy.

The word is technically a neuter noun (das Thermostat), though you might occasionally hear masculine usage (der Thermostat) in colloquial speech or specific technical regions. However, for learners, sticking to the neuter gender is the safest and most grammatically correct path in standard German (Hochdeutsch). The plural form is die Thermostate. In the context of the 'Energiewende' (energy transition), the efficiency of these devices has become a major topic of public discourse.

Beyond the home, the word appears in automotive contexts. If your car is overheating, the mechanic might say, 'Das Thermostat öffnet nicht mehr,' meaning the valve that allows coolant to flow to the radiator is stuck. This demonstrates the word's versatility across mechanical and domestic spheres. Because Germans value precision and efficiency, knowing the specific parts of a system, like the Thermostat, allows for clearer communication with landlords, technicians, and roommates.

Compound Words
German loves compounds. You will see words like Funkthermostat (wireless), Heizkörperthermostat (radiator), and Raumthermostat (wall-mounted room unit).

Using the word Thermostat correctly involves understanding its grammatical role as a neuter noun and its relationship with verbs of adjustment. In German, we don't just 'turn' a thermostat; we 'adjust' (einstellen), 'turn up' (hochdrehen), or 'turn down' (runterdrehen/niedriger stellen) the device. Because it is a physical object, it often appears in the accusative case when it is the direct object of these actions.

With Separable Verbs
Verbs like hochdrehen (to turn up) are very common. 'Ich drehe das Thermostat hoch.' Notice how the prefix 'hoch' moves to the end of the sentence.
Expressing Malfunction
If the device is broken, use defekt or kaputt. 'Das Thermostat scheint defekt zu sein, da die Heizung immer auf Hochtouren läuft.'

For English speakers, the word Thermostat seems like an easy 'cognate' (a word that looks the same in both languages). However, this similarity is a double-edged sword that leads to several common pitfalls in pronunciation, gender, and usage. Avoiding these mistakes will make your German sound much more natural and professional.

Pronunciation: The 'Th' Trap
The biggest mistake is using the English 'th' sound (either voiced as in 'this' or unvoiced as in 'think'). In German, 'Th' is always pronounced as a hard 'T'. Saying 'Thermostat' with an English 'th' will immediately mark you as a beginner.
Gender Confusion
While 'der Thermostat' is sometimes used, the standard Duden-approved gender is 'das Thermostat'. Many learners default to 'der' because many technical instruments in German are masculine (e.g., der Computer, der Motor). Stick to 'das' for exams and formal writing.

Falsch: Ich drehe den Thermostat hoch.
Richtig: Ich drehe das Thermostat hoch.

Another mistake involves the plural form. Learners often try to use English-style plurals like 'Thermostats'. The correct German plural is die Thermostate. Remember to add that 'e' at the end! Additionally, confusion often arises when describing the 'setting' of the thermostat. In English, we might say 'The thermostat is on 3'. In German, it's more precise to say 'Das Thermostat steht auf Stufe 3' or 'Das Thermostat ist auf 3 eingestellt'. Using 'an' (as in 'Das Thermostat ist an 3') is a literal translation from English that sounds awkward in German.

Falsch: Das Thermostat ist auf 20 Grad gesetzt.
Richtig: Das Thermostat ist auf 20 Grad eingestellt.

Finally, watch out for the verb 'to turn'. While 'drehen' is correct for the physical act of twisting a dial, if you are using a digital interface, 'einstellen' or 'regulieren' is better. If you say 'Ich drehe das digitale Thermostat', it sounds like you are physically rotating the whole device rather than changing the setting. Precision in verb choice is a hallmark of reaching the B2/C1 levels from B1.

Spelling Error
Some learners write 'Termostat' without the 'h'. While it sounds the same, the 'h' is mandatory in German spelling for this Greek-derived word.

While Thermostat is the most common term, German offers several synonyms and related words depending on the context and the level of technicality required. Knowing these alternatives will help you understand more complex texts and describe specific situations more accurately.

Temperaturregler
Literally 'temperature regulator'. This is a more descriptive term often used in technical manuals or when referring to the dial on an oven or iron. Thermostat usually implies an automatic feedback loop, whereas Temperaturregler can be simpler.
Heizungsregler
Specifically refers to the control for a heating system. If you are talking to a heating technician, they might use this term to refer to the central control unit of the whole house.

In a domestic setting, people often refer to the 'Thermostatkopf' (thermostat head), which is the specific plastic part you turn on the radiator. If only that part is broken, you might say, 'Ich brauche einen neuen Thermostatkopf.' Another related term is 'Raumtemperaturregler', which specifically refers to the wall-mounted unit that controls the temperature for an entire room or apartment. This is common in modern buildings with underfloor heating (Fußbodenheizung).

Moderne Heizkörperthermostate lassen sich zeitlich programmieren.

When discussing smart home technology, you will hear 'Smart-Home-Thermostat' or 'WLAN-Thermostat'. These are becoming increasingly popular in Germany as people look for ways to reduce their carbon footprint and save money. In contrast, an older, non-automatic valve might be called a 'Handventil', though these are rare in modern heating systems. Understanding these nuances allows you to be more specific: 'Ist das ein einfaches Thermostat oder ein programmierbarer Regler?'

Hitzewächter / Temperaturbegrenzer
These are safety devices that shut off a system if it gets too hot. While they function like a thermostat, their purpose is safety (safety shut-off) rather than constant regulation.

Thermostat vs Thermometer

Both start with 'Thermo' and relate to temperature.

A thermometer is passive (reading only), while a thermostat is active (controlling).

Das Thermometer zeigt 20 Grad, aber das Thermostat steht auf 5.

Thermostat vs Heizung

Often used interchangeably in casual talk.

Heizung is the whole system; Thermostat is the specific control part.

Die Heizung ist an, aber das Thermostat ist kaputt.

Thermostat vs Fühler

Both are parts of a regulation system.

The Fühler is the sensor; the Thermostat is the device containing the sensor.

Der Fühler im Thermostat ist verschmutzt.

Thermostat vs Schalter

Both change the state of a device.

A switch is binary (on/off); a thermostat is variable and automatic.

Das ist kein Schalter, sondern ein Thermostat.

Thermostat vs Klimaanlage

Both regulate room climate.

Klimaanlage is the AC system; Thermostat is the component that tells it when to run.

Die Klimaanlage wird über ein Wand-Thermostat gesteuert.

Saving Energy

In Germany, turning the thermostat down by just 1 degree can save about 6% of heating energy. This is a common topic in German media.

Stuck Valves

If your heater stays cold even when the thermostat is on 5, the little pin behind the thermostat might be stuck. This is a common winter problem in Germany.

Frost Protection

Never turn the thermostat completely off in winter if you leave for vacation; keep it on the '*' (Sternchen) to prevent pipe bursts.

Origem da palavra

Derived from the Ancient Greek words 'thermos' (warm/hot) and 'statos' (standing/staying). It was coined to describe a device that keeps heat at a standing or constant level.

Significado original: A device for maintaining a constant temperature.

Contexto cultural

Be careful when discussing heating with landlords; it's a common point of conflict regarding utility bills.

In the US/UK, many homes have central air/heat controlled by one wall unit. In Germany, individual radiator thermostats are much more common.
